Tobias Braun - Vicente Arias 1889 model


Tobias Braun - classical guitar
   
Country : Austria - Gaaden
 Year : 2021
Scale length : 65 cm
Top : Spruce
Back & side Indian rosewood
Neck : Spanish cedar - 52 mm
Fingerboard : Ebony 
Tuners : Alessi
Body length : 460 mm
Body width : 247/204/330 mm
Body depth : 86/92 mm
Weight : 1 156 g
Action : 2,5/3,5 mm
Condition : New

Tobias Braun was born in 1960 in Holzminden - Germany, the following year his parents moved to Vienna - Austria. He studied German literature and journalism. In 1983, he built his first guitar on his own. The following year he began a long period of apprenticeships with José Romanillos. In 1990, he contributed to the German translation of Romanillos' book "Antonio de Torres". GuitarMaker - His Life and Work".

 

This beautiful guitar is a copy of a 1889 Vicente Arias. As always, the work of lutherie is perfectly realized. Although small in size (faithful to the original) it is a powerful and responsive guitar. The basses are round and deep, the trebles are clear and vibrant, the woody tone reproduces the charm of old instruments.
